Question
A group of young men booked transportation, and at the last moment, one of them canceled his participation, causing the trip to become more expensive for the other passengers. If they had known in advance that he would not travel, they would not have booked the transportation. Is the young man who canceled obligated to pay the additional cost?
Answer
He is obligated to pay.
Source
Choshen Mishpat 333
